| (In millions) | Three Months Ended June 30, 2026 | Three Months Ended June 30, 2025 | Six Months Ended June 30, 2026 | Six Months Ended June 30, 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Fiduciary interest income | 88 | 99 | 173 | 202 |
| Total Risk and Insurance Services | $4,823 | $4,625 | $9,874 | $9,387 |
| Mercer: | ||||
| Wealth | $740 | $685 | $1,492 | $1,355 |
| Health | 611 | 594 | 1,272 | 1,202 |
| Career | 247 | 219 | 495 | 437 |
| Total Mercer | 1,598 | 1,498 | 3,259 | 2,994 |
| Marsh Management Consulting | 1,004 | 873 | 1,901 | 1,691 |

- What does wealth — revenue mean?
- This metric represents the total top-line income generated by the company's Wealth segment, which typically encompasses human resource consulting, retirement services, and investment advisory solutions. It serves as a primary indicator of the firm's ability to capture market share and deliver value within the professional services and human capital consulting landscape. Tracking this revenue stream helps investors assess the segment's growth trajectory and its contribution to the overall enterprise financial performance.
